Job description

Job Description

Responsible for supplying raw materials and supplies to production lines using very methods and tools.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ities
  • Follows all company safety rules and policies.
  • Orders and releases raw materials.
  • Liaises between production and purchasing.
  • Conducts inventory and cycle counts and investigations.
  • Reads work orders, production schedules or follows visual and oral instructions to determine materials to be moved, what parts are to be retrieved from receiving and where on the production line to position the specific parts for use by production employees.
  • Knows, or can learn, manufacturing processes, receiving and production floor parts inventory procedures.
  • Owns the kanban replenishment process, including maintenance of kanban bins/locations, visual parts, setup, and proper replenishment requests.
  • Removes and delivers damaged parts off the production floor to the proper site.
  • Operates forklift in a safe productive manner.
  • Works cooperatively and congenially with co-workers to achieve cohesive and productive work processes and work environment.
  • Performs additional tasks as assigned by management or as the situation requires.
Qualifications
  • Ability to follow verbal and written instructions.
  • Ability to read and follow work orders.
  • Ability to perform basic computer operation tasks and capable of learning programs used in kanban and production areas of the company including ERP Software, spreadsheets, and email.
  • Possess a certified forklift operator license and a minimum of one-year experience. OSHA trained.
  • Familiarity or ability to learn lean flow manufacturing concepts.
